Why Petrochemical Support Roles Are Overlooked
Most candidates and agencies default to construction sourcing because volume is higher and matching criteria are more familiar. Petrochemical is viewed as engineering-only - which is incorrect for a significant category of support and maintenance positions.
Non-engineering roles in petrochemical operations that Indian workers regularly fill:
- GRP/RTRP fitter (Glass Reinforced Plastic piping - ITI Fitter trade, no engineering degree required)
- Instrument technician (ITI Electronics or Instrumentation + 2 years experience)
- Piping fitter and welder (ITI Welding - CSWIP 3.1 or ASME certification a strong advantage)
- QC inspector (visual and dimensional inspection - ITI trades with NDT Level I/II)
- Process operator helper (no specific trade, but NEBOSH/IOSH basic safety certification required)
- Logistics and materials controller (warehouse management, inventory - no trade cert required)
- Laboratory assistant (ITI Chemical or Science graduate - sample handling, basic analysis)
Where Demand Is Highest in 2026
Kuwait - Al-Zour and Mina Abdullah
Kuwait National Petroleum Company's Al-Zour refinery is the world's largest single-site refinery by capacity at 615,000 barrels per day. Phase 2 operational scale-up runs through 2027. Maintenance technicians, instrument specialists, and operations support positions account for over 3,000 open requisitions as of Q1 2026 (KNPC Manpower Planning data, Q1 2026).
Indian workers fill approximately 65% of technical and support staff at Al-Zour - this is an established sourcing pipeline expanding in scale, not a new one.
Saudi Arabia - Aramco, SABIC, and NEOM Oxagon
Saudi Aramco's Ras Tanura refinery, SABIC's Jubail Industrial City complex, and the downstream Yanbu operations collectively represent the world's largest concentration of petrochemical employment. NEOM's Oxagon industrial port (opened 2025) is generating additional manufacturing and process support roles currently being filled through open Saudi intake cycles.
For Indian workers with ITI welding, piping, or instrumentation credentials, Saudi Aramco pre-qualification - available through RLA-licensed agencies - is the pathway that opens direct contractor assignment. Pre-qual typically adds 2 - 3 weeks to the placement timeline but significantly increases placement success rate.
UAE - ADNOC Ruwais Expansion
ADNOC's Ruwais complex in Abu Dhabi is undergoing a USD 3.6 billion expansion programme through 2026. Roles are sourced through ADNOC's contractor network - Bechtel, Technip, and local ADNOC Engineering subsidiaries. Standard contract cycles run 2 - 3 years with renewal options.
Salary Comparison: Construction vs Petrochemical
| Grade level | Construction (USD/mo) | Petrochemical (USD/mo) | Premium |
|---|---|---|---|
| Fitter / Technician (ITI entry) | 450 - 550 | 580 - 750 | +25 - 35% |
| Senior Technician / Inspector | 600 - 800 | 850 - 1,200 | +40 - 50% |
| Supervisor / Team Lead | 820 - 1,100 | 1,200 - 1,800 | +40 - 60% |
Source: Compiled from RLA agency outcome reports and KNPC/Aramco contractor salary disclosures, Q1 2026. USD equivalent at July 2026 rates. Competitive salary range - subject to employer contract and site tier.
Accommodation, food, and transport allowances are standard in petrochemical contracts - most roles are residential site assignments. Confirm full package breakdown before signing, not just the base salary figure.
What Gets You Shortlisted
For non-engineering petrochemical support roles, the shortlisting criteria are consistent across most Gulf employers:
ITI trade certificate (NCVT-recognized): Electrician, Fitter, Welder, Instrument Mechanic, or Chemical Plant Operator trades are the most frequently matched categories.
Supplementary certifications that accelerate shortlisting:
- CSWIP 3.1 or AWS CWI (welding inspectors)
- ASNT Level II (NDT inspection - radiography, ultrasonic, magnetic particle)
- H2S Awareness certificate (mandatory on most Gulf petrochemical sites)
- NEBOSH General Certificate or IOSH Working Safely (for operations support roles)
- BOSIET (Basic Offshore Safety Induction and Emergency Training - for offshore-adjacent roles)
Workers without supplementary certs are placed - but candidates with ITI plus H2S plus one safety certificate consistently receive faster shortlisting decisions from petrochemical contractors.
Application and Processing Timeline
Petrochemical placement cycles are longer than construction. Most Aramco and KNPC contractor assignments require:
- Trade verification (DataFlow plus GAMCA equivalent): 10 - 14 days
- Client pre-qualification interview (video): arranged by the agency after document clearance
- Offer letter: 5 - 10 days after pre-qual approval
- Visa processing: 15 - 25 days
Total typical timeline: 35 - 55 days from application to visa issuance. Agencies should not commit candidates to a 30-day window for petrochemical assignments - the client screening is thorough and cannot be compressed.
